.ellipsis{over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.oneRows{-webkit-line-clamp:1}.oneRows,.twoRows{white-space:normal;display:-webkit-box;overflow:hidden;text-overflow:ellipsis;-webkit-box-orient:vertical}.twoRows{-webkit-line-clamp:2}.buy-membercard__content{padding:.533333rem}.buy-membercard__content .desc{padding:0;font-size:.9em}.buy-membercard__content>div+div{margin-top:.266667rem}.buy-membercard__content .btn{text-align:center;margin:.266667rem}.buy-membercard__content .btn>.van-button{width:3.2rem}.buy-membercard__content .goods{border-radius:.32rem}.buy-membercard__content .goods .header{padding:.533333rem}.buy-membercard__content .goods .price{height:2.133333rem;display:flex;justify-content:center;align-items:center}.buy-membercard__content .goods .price .text{font-size:.8rem}.buy-membercard__content .goods .price .num{margin-left:.133333rem;padding:.133333rem .266667rem;border-radius:.8rem;background:#ff6969;margin-top:.133333rem}.buy-membercard__content .goods .num{border-top:.026667rem solid #d7d7d7;display:flex;justify-content:space-around;align-items:center}.buy-membercard__content .goods .num>div{width:50%;height:1.066667rem;display:flex;justify-content:center;align-items:center}.buy-membercard__content .goods .num i{font-size:.533333rem}.buy-membercard__content .goods .num>div:first-child{border-right:.026667rem solid #d7d7d7}.buy-membercard .buy-membercard__content.used-num{margin-top:.533333rem}.buy-membercard-header{background:#ff6969;padding:.533333rem;text-align:center;border-radius:0 0 .4rem .4rem;height:2.666667rem;box-sizing:border-box;position:relative}.buy-membercard-header>div+div{margin-top:.533333rem}.buy-membercard-header .name{font-size:.533333rem}.buy-membercard-header .coupon-card{background:#ffeaea;margin-top:0!important;display:flex;justify-content:space-between;align-items:center;padding:.533333rem .266667rem;border-radius:.133333rem;color:#ff6969;position:absolute;left:.533333rem;right:.533333rem;box-sizing:border-box;bottom:-.8rem}.buy-membercard-header .coupon-card .num{font-size:.8rem;font-weight:700;padding:0 .053333rem}.buy-membercard-header .coupon-card .btn{padding:.16rem .426667rem;border-radius:.533333rem}.buy-membercard .images{margin-bottom:1.6rem}.buy-membercard .button__bottom{display:flex;justify-content:space-between;align-items:center}.buy-membercard .button__bottom .van-button{width:4rem;background:linear-gradient(90.8deg,#ffaaa8 31%,#fe8a71 65%,#fd6c39)}.buy-membercard .button__bottom .total{display:flex;align-items:center}.buy-membercard .button__bottom .total .price{color:#fd7142;font-size:.586667rem;margin-right:.133333rem}.buy-membercard .button__bottom .total .num{color:#646566;margin-top:.133333rem;font-size:.9em}